What affects the price

When you call for a chimney repair estimate, several variables influence the total. The height of your chimney and how easily we can reach the roof play a big part. The specific materials needed—whether it’s custom brick matching, stainless steel liners, or specialized mortar—also affect your final bill. If there is hidden internal damage like crumbling flue tiles or structural shifting, that requires more labor and specialized equipment than a simple exterior patch. We always evaluate the extent of the wear and tear to give you a clear picture of what’s needed to keep your home safe.

Is chimney repair covered under homeowners insurance?

Homeowners insurance in San Jose might cover chimney repairs if the damage was caused by a sudden, accidental event, such as a lightning strike or a house fire. However, it typically won't cover repairs due to normal wear and tear or lack of maintenance. It's always a good idea to check your specific policy details or call your insurance provider for clarification.

What is the 3 to 10 rule for chimneys?

The '3 to 10 rule' for chimneys generally refers to ensuring the chimney extends at least 3 feet above the highest point of your roof that it passes through, and is at least 2 feet higher than any part of the roof within a 10-foot radius. This helps prevent downdrafts and ensures proper ventilation for your San Jose home.
